Nortel BCM Business Phone Systems

Business Communications Manager (BCM) delivers small/medium-sized businesses and branch offices the only converged voice/data solution in the industry, providing a choice of IP-enabled or pure-IP strategy. Leveraging existing Meridian, Norstar, and Communication Server 1000 investments, BCM has the capabilities businesses need including telephony, unified messaging, multimedia call center, interactive voice response, IP routing and data services such as firewall, wireless, and more.

Business Communication Managers

The Business Communications Manager 50 is designed specifically for the small to medium business. The BCM 50 is an all-in-one, affordable platform for converged voice and data communications with 3 to 20 stations, yet scalable to serve more than 40 stations.

  • Target User: 3-20
  • Number of digital stations: 4-44
  • Number of IP stations: 32
  • Number of voice mail ports: 10

The Business Communications Manager 200 is ideal for sites with 20 to 32 users, offering flexible deployment and expansion options with two bays for your choice of media bay modules.

  • Target User: 20-30
  • Number of digital stations: 16-48
  • Number of IP stations: 90
  • Number of voice mail ports: 32

The Business Communications Manager 400 serves sites with 30 to 200 users, with four bays for media bay modules plus the option to add an expansion chassis for additional media modules.

  • Target User: 30-400
  • Number of digital stations: 32-192
  • Number of IP stations: 90
  • Number of voice mail ports: 32


System Overview

Business Communications Manager Overview

  • Cost-effective scalability from 10 to 200+ stations using a mix of digital and IP stations.
  • Simplified network infrastructure cuts costs by connecting IP phones over the LAN wiring system, seamlessly extending features to multiple sites through IP connectivity and streamlining network management. IP trunking enables a business to optimize network bandwidth and reduce network costs.
  • Redundancy options, including power, fans and hard-drive, automatically detect failures and switches over seamlessly without any loss of service. This optional feature provides protection where security and reliability are the key drivers to communications systems.
  • Browser-based management simplifies installations, and provides an intuitive, wizards-based method of managing the network from any Web-enabled workstation.
  • Unparalleled telephony features - with the most complete telephony feature offering for small sites, no business has to make compromises on how to process critical customer calls.
  • Full suite of applications - including voice messaging, unified messaging, interactive voice response, multimedia call center and wireless, enable your business to streamline costs, be more productive, and better serve customers.

System Features & Benefits

IP Telephony supports powerful new e-business applications that level the playing field with larger competitors, extend network services to remote workers, increase portability, simplify moves and changes, and eliminate toll charges on site-to-site calls.

Universal Internet Access for all connected users and workstations, including access to corporate intranets, support for intra-site Virtual Private Networks (VPNs), and remote connectivity for mobile or home users.

Call Center Applications combine the reach of the Web with personalized agent interaction and customer support.

Wireless Solutions break the chains that tie users to their workstations, giving Call Center agents hands-on access to samples and supporting wireless scanners for efficient inventory procedures.

Hybrid Environment leverages existing investments in Meridian, Norstar and Communication Server 1000 systems, offering a future-proof migration strategy.

Unified Messaging allows users to manage all their voice, fax, and e-mail messages from a single application on their multimedia-equipped PC or laptop.

Interactive Voice Response allows businesses to offload routine transaction and customers to access pertinent information 24 hours a day, 365 days a year.

Centralized Voice Mail and Management The networking capabilities of IP telephony make centralized applications for messaging and management more cost effective than ever before. Enterprises receive the benefits of standard greetings, global administration, and a common interface across their network.

Nortel BCM Options At-a-Glance

Business Communication Manager 50

Business Communication Manager 200

Business Communication Manager 400

IP/digital mobility - X X
Cordless mobility X X X
Basic Call Center X X X
Professional Call Center - X X
Multimedia Call Center - X X
IVR - X X
IP music on hold - X X
VPN tunnels 5 16 16
IP trunks 12 60 60
Integrated DSL X - -
Integrated frame relay - X X
